How CBT and remote care work together

Harold uses Cognitive Behavioral Therapy, which helps people notice how thoughts, feelings, and actions interact. CBT focuses on practical exercises and small changes in thinking and behavior to reduce anxiety and improve mood. It is often used for stress, panic, depression, and problems with coping skills.

Finding the right approach happens together. He will talk with each person about goals and try strategies that fit their needs and preferences. If an idea does not help, he will adjust the plan so it becomes useful in day-to-day life.

Online therapy offers ways to make care fit a busy life. Video calls allow face-to-face conversation when depth and nonverbal cues matter. Phone sessions use less bandwidth and can be easier to fit into a short break. Live chat or text messaging work well for brief check-ins, follow-up notes, or practicing new skills between longer sessions. These options increase flexibility and make it easier to keep momentum on the work you set out to do.
